Most of this is food and beverage — typically meals provided during product presentations at a clinic or hospital. Nationally that is the single largest category of reported payments by count.

Companies that both paid and supply prescribed drugs

These companies both reported payments to this provider and make drugs the provider prescribed under Medicare Part D in 2024. For most specialties this overlap is expected — a cardiologist who is paid by a cardiology drugmaker also treats heart disease. It is shown so the reader can see it, not because it implies anything on its own.
